[ARCHIVED] Snow Removal Plan for January 25th & 26th, 2016

The City of Watertown received more than 2 inches of snow accumulation on January 25th, 2016. As a result, the Watertown Street Department will be plowing today.

On Monday, January 25th, 2016 the Watertown Street Department will be plowing highways 212, 81 and 20 followed by emergency snow routes.

On Tuesday, January 26th, 2016 beginning at 3 am, the Watertown Street Department will be plowing the Uptown business district followed by avenues.

Streets are plowed on: Monday, Wednesday and Friday

Avenues are plowed on: Tuesday, Thursday and Saturday

Parking on streets, avenues or snow routes during the days they are scheduled to be plowed will result in a $40 fine (fine doubles to $80 if not paid in 3 days).

Please assist us by not parking on the roadways during the time that roadway is scheduled to be plowed.

Officers will do same day ticketing of vehicles blocking the snow plows from clearing the city’s streets and avenues. If the obstructing vehicles remain on the street longer than 24 hours after being plowed around, it will be towed at the expense of the owner.

There is also a fine for blowing snow into the street from a driveway or sidewalk.
